8.8.9. Delete EDID from memory

Description: Clear EDID from memory location <loc>.
Command {DE<loc>}
Response (DE_OK)CrLf
Explanation: All user EDIDs are cleared from memory.
Legend: Depending on <loc>, one EDID, or all EDIDs in a block can be cleared.
